The “LT” badge stands for “Longtail,” a legacy inherited from McLaren’s 1990s endurance racing roots. The 765LT takes everything the 720S pioneered and intensifies it: more power, more downforce, more grip, and more adrenaline.
Powered by a 4.0-liter twin-turbo V8 producing 755 hp, the 765LT launches from 0–100 km/h in just 2.7 seconds. But numbers alone can’t describe it. This car feels like it shrinks around you. The steering is telepathic, the brakes violent, and the acceleration relentless. The titanium exhaust delivers a razor-sharp soundtrack that crackles on overrun, reminding you that the 765LT is alive.
McLaren stripped weight everywhere possible. Carbon fiber seats, thinner glass, lightweight suspension components, and a recalibrated transmission reduce mass by over 80 kg compared to the 720S. The result? A car that feels like it’s reading the racetrack before your hands even touch the wheel.
Collectors love the 765LT because McLaren produced just 765 units worldwide. This orange example at Pupil of Fate Motors is especially desirable because the color reflects McLaren’s racing heritage—Bruce McLaren’s legendary Papaya Orange.
